Teams Gear Up for Epic Boeing 737 Pull at Bournemouth Airport
On August 31, three teams will gather at Bournemouth Airport for the Dorset Plane Pull charity event. Their mission? To pull a massive Boeing 737 weighing 35,000kg over 50 metres.
The event aims to raise £3,000 to support local mental health services provided by Dorset Mind. The organization offers peer support group sessions, wellbeing programmes, and community connections for those struggling with their mental health.
Teams Durable UK and Manutan, ActionCOACH, and CrossFit Durnovaria have each assembled up to 20 people to take on the challenge. Emma Murgatroyd from Dorset Mind said, 'It's amazing to see local businesses and community organisations coming together for such a memorable challenge.'
The funds raised will directly support Dorset Mind's mental health services, giving individuals access to vital support and resources.
